Spectroscopic Measurements of Impurity Ion Toroidal and Poloidal Flow Velocities and Their Dependence on Vertical Magnetic Field in QUEST Toroidal ECR Plasmas

Abstract: Toroidal electron cyclotron resonance (ECR) plasma is an ECR heated plasma in an open toroidal magnetic field. The plasma contains no toroidal current and is used for the pre-ionization and non-inductive startup of a tokamak plasma.
